10853677283 has 2 divisors, whose sum is σ = 10853677284. Its totient is φ = 10853677282.
The previous prime is 10853677223. The next prime is 10853677301. The reversal of 10853677283 is 38277635801.
It is a happy number.
It is a strong prime.
It is a cyclic number.
It is not a de Polignac number, because 10853677283 - 228 = 10585241827 is a prime.
It is not a weakly prime, because it can be changed into another prime (10853677213) by changing a digit.
It is a polite number, since it can be written as a sum of consecutive naturals, namely, 5426838641 + 5426838642.
It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(5426838642).
Almost surely, 210853677283 is an apocalyptic number.
10853677283 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(1).
10853677283 is an equidigital number, since it uses as much as digits as its factorization.
10853677283 is an evil number, because the sum of its binary digits is even.
The product of its (nonzero) digits is 1693440, while the sum is 50.
The spelling of 10853677283 in words is "ten billion, eight hundred fifty-three million, six hundred seventy-seven thousand, two hundred eighty-three".
